Why Relationship Compatibility Readings Often Get It Wrong
## Answer Capsule
Most compatibility readings get it wrong not because the system is flawed, but because they ask the wrong question. "Are we compatible?" is a yes-or-no question, and destiny charts do not produce yes-or-no answers. They describe the *structure* of a relationship — what pulls two people together, where the friction naturally arises, and what the long-term pattern tends to look like. The better question is: "What kind of relationship are we, and what does that mean for how we handle each other?"
## The "Compatible or Not" Problem
Compatibility readings that produce a simple pass-fail verdict are almost always oversimplified. Two charts can show elemental clashes in one area and deep complementarity in another. A couple with significant friction in their communication patterns may have powerful financial alignment and shared life-stage timing. A couple with smooth surface compatibility may have a structural imbalance that becomes visible only under pressure.
Real compatibility analysis describes the *texture* of the relationship, not its viability.
## What a Good Compatibility Reading Actually Shows
**Attraction structure:** Which elements between the two charts create magnetism — and whether that attraction is sustainable or tends to burn out.
**Friction points:** Where the two charts create systematic pressure on each other. Knowing this in advance does not make the friction disappear, but it makes it less surprising and more navigable.
**Timing alignment:** Whether both people are in similar life phases. Two people with completely different timing cycles — one in a decade of expansion, one in a decade of contraction — often find it difficult to want the same things at the same time.
**Long-term structure:** Whether the chart interaction points toward a relationship that stabilizes and deepens over time, or one that is intense and transformative but not built for permanence.
## What Compatibility Reading Cannot Do
It cannot tell you whether the relationship is worth pursuing. It cannot predict whether feelings will last. It cannot account for the choices both people make once they are inside the relationship.
Two people with a structurally difficult compatibility can build something lasting through understanding and effort. Two people with structurally easy compatibility can still drift apart through neglect.

**Q: If our charts show major clashes, should we not be together?**
A: Chart clashes between partners are common and do not predict relationship failure. They predict where the structural friction will tend to appear. Knowing this allows both people to approach those areas with more patience and intentionality rather than assuming the other person is simply being difficult.
**Q: Does birth order or gender affect compatibility readings?**
A: In BaZi and Zi Wei Dou Shu, the interaction is based on the chart structures themselves — the elemental dynamics do not change based on gender assignment or birth order. Western astrology interprets some elements through gendered archetypes, but the structural analysis remains chart-based.
